Shannon Miller is a seven-time Olympic medalist, two-time US Olympic Hall of Fame inductee, and one of the most accomplished gymnasts of all time. Her extraordinary competitive record includes 59 international and 49 national medals, back-to-back World All-Around Titles, and groundbreaking achievements that reshaped American gymnastics. Shannon first captured global attention in the early 1990s with unmatched technical precision, discipline, and competitive grit. Her historic performance at the 1992 Barcelona Olympics, earning five medals, established her as a trailblazer for future US athletes.
The pinnacle of her career came at the 1996 Atlanta Olympics, where she helped lead the “Magnificent Seven” to Team Gold and secured her own individual Gold on the Balance Beam, becoming the first American gymnast to win the event at a fully attended summer games. Her athletic success, marked by resilience and unwavering focus under pressure, continues to inspire audiences worldwide.

Shannon Miller’s journey to greatness began with her historic triumphs in the early 1990s, marking her as a trailblazer in American gymnastics. Her unprecedented feat of becoming the first US gymnast to clinch consecutive World All-Around Titles in 1993 and 1994 showcased her unparalleled talent and unwavering dedication.
However, it was on the Olympic stage where Miller truly left an indelible mark. At the 1992 Barcelona Olympics, her five-medal haul, including two silver and three bronze, elevated her to the summit of American sporting achievement, setting a precedent for future generations.
The pinnacle of Miller’s illustrious career arrived at the 1996 Atlanta Olympics, where she led the “Magnificent Seven” to the US Women’s first-ever Team Gold. In a historic moment, she secured Gold on the Balance Beam, becoming the first American gymnast to achieve such a feat at a fully-attended summer games. Her triumph not only solidified her status as the most accomplished gymnast in US Olympic history but also inspired countless individuals worldwide to pursue their dreams relentlessly.
Following her retirement from competitive gymnastics, Shannon Miller embarked on a new chapter dedicated to empowering others. Armed with undergraduate degrees in marketing and entrepreneurship from the University of Houston and a law degree from Boston College, she transitioned seamlessly from Olympic athlete to advocate for the health and wellness of women and children. Through her work as a motivational speaker, author, and cancer survivor, Miller continues to inspire audiences with her message of resilience, perseverance, and the pursuit of excellence.

In this three-minute highlight reel, Shannon Miller shares her continued connection to the Olympic movement, serving as an analyst and commentator who attends the Games every four years. Watching athletes march into competition instantly transports her back to her own experiences, especially the unforgettable moments from the 1996 Olympic Games in Atlanta.
Shannon recalls the overwhelming energy of walking into the Georgia Dome in front of 40,000 people cheering for Team USA. The roar of the crowd, the flash bulbs, and the sea of red, white, and blue created an atmosphere unlike anything she had ever experienced. With that support came immense pressure, but by the end of the night she and her teammates made history as the first US women’s gymnastics team to win Olympic Team Gold. Shannon describes the achievement as a dream come true and one of the defining highlights of her career.
